Question 626: To ask the Minister for Health the number of private houses purchased by the his Department or the Health Service Executive as part of community care initiatives in Kilkenny city and county; the cost of this property purchase over the past five years; if all properties are in use; if not, the number of vacant properties and the cost of same; if such projects have been successful in the context of the support of the wider community; and if he will make a statement on the matter. My Department has not purchased property in Kilkenny city and county in the past five years.
Management of the Health Service Executive property estate is a service matter. Therefore your question has been referred to the Executive for direct reply.
